There are several sociological theories that explain the view that changes in the workplace mean that there are no longer distinct differences between non-manual and manual workers in the UK today.
Harry Braverman (1974) argued that the lower middle class are being subjected to proletarianisation. He argued that most routine, white-collar jobs have become so de-skilled, due to the advancement of technology, that they now differ little fro manual work. This means that they have lost their economic and social adavantages that they previously enjoyed over manual workers. As technology has improved, it has been used to break down the more complex white collar skills into simple, routine tasks. As a result, the workers have lost control over the work process and are now more like factory workers.
